The XC5204VQ100 is a Field-Programmable Gate Array (FPGA) from Xilinx, belonging to the XC5200 family. FPGAs provide a reprogrammable hardware platform, enabling designers to implement custom digital logic circuits after manufacturing. They are widely used in applications requiring flexibility, rapid prototyping, or hardware acceleration.
Applications:
- Data acquisition systems
- Digital signal processing
- Image processing
- Telecommunications
- Networking equipment
- Embedded systems
Features:
- Configurable Logic Blocks (CLBs)
- Programmable interconnect resources
- Input/Output Blocks (IOBs)
- On-chip RAM
- VQ100 package (100-pin Very Thin Quad Flatpack)
- SRAM-based configuration
Benefits:
- Flexibility to implement custom logic
- Reprogrammability for design changes or upgrades
- Hardware acceleration for improved performance
- Shorter time-to-market compared to ASICs
- Cost-effective solution for low to medium volume production
The XC5204VQ100 provides a versatile and configurable hardware platform for implementing various digital logic functions. The CLBs are the basic building blocks of the FPGA, allowing designers to implement custom logic circuits. The programmable interconnect resources enable flexible routing of signals between CLBs and IOBs. The on-chip RAM provides storage for data and intermediate results. The VQ100 package is a 100-pin Very Thin Quad Flatpack package, offering a compact footprint for space-constrained applications. The SRAM-based configuration allows the FPGA to be reconfigured quickly and easily. Designs are typically implemented using Hardware Description Languages (HDLs) like VHDL or Verilog, and synthesized using Xilinx's design tools.